ZIP 72076 and ZIP 72086 are ZIP Code areas in Arkansas.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 72076 has the higher population (38,647 vs 12,250 in ZIP 72086). ZIP 72086 has the higher median household income ($59,450 vs $53,048 in ZIP 72076). ZIP 72076 has the higher median home value ($155,600 vs $151,700 in ZIP 72086).
